# Break-Glass Access: Wavecrest Preview Service

The Wavecrest audio waveform preview pipeline normally requires team-lead approval for production access. In an incident, break-glass entry bypasses approval but triggers an audit alert to the Pellerin security channel. All sessions are recorded and reviewed within 48 hours. To open the break-glass vault, enter the passphrase below.

unlock words, fafop-hawep: briwyn-oliix-sorox

### Step 4: Cut over the user module

The Orvantine user module now runs as its own service (user-core). Stop dual-writes only after the backfill job reports zero drift for 24h. Point the monolith's auth shim at user-core via USER_CORE_URL in the deploy env file. Keep read fallback enabled for one release cycle. user-core validates inbound calls with a shared service credential; rotate it per the standard quarterly schedule. In the env file, directly under USER_CORE_URL, add the credential line:

secret setting of tawif-tajop: COURIER_KEY13=819c65d82d2bd

## Fan-out Service — Stormrelay API

The Stormrelay fan-out service receives validated weather alerts from the Cloudgate ingester and distributes them to subscriber channels in priority order. Each outbound request is idempotent and carries a delivery token; retries back off exponentially up to five attempts. Maintainers should note that the internal Cloudgate ingester rejects unauthenticated calls with a 403 rather than a 401, which historically confused retry logic. All calls to the ingester must include the service key shown below.

gateway credential: kto3_qfe

Finance Review Summary — Tessaline Works, Heads of Department

The Operations budget request of 1.4M for the Greymoor facility upgrade was reviewed in detail. Capital items are justified; however, the contingency line at 18% exceeds policy and should be reduced to 10%. Approval is recommended subject to that adjustment and a phased drawdown tied to milestones. The request should be read alongside the confidential plan noted below.

board note of kageg-bahof: The renewal with Holwynax Holdings closes at $2 million a year, 5 percent below the last contract. Project Ulaath slips by two quarters because of the supplier delay.